Act Name: The Delhi Lands (Restrictions on Transfer) Act, 1972

Year: 1972

Enactment Date: 1972-06-14

Long Title: An Act to impose certain restrictions on transfer of lands which have been acquired by the Central Government or in respect of which acquisition proceedings have been initiated by that Government, with a view to preventing large-scale transactions of purported transfers or, as the case may be, transfers of such lands to unwary public.

Ministry: Ministry of Housing and Urban Affairs

Department:

Section 7: Period of operation of orders of refusal to grant permission to transfer land.
    Where the competent authority has made any order under section 5 refusing to grant permission to transfer any land or where, an appeal having been filed against such order, the prescribed authority has made an order under section 6 confirming such order, then, the order refusing to grant permission to transfer such land shall be in operation only for a period of three years from the date of the order made by the competent authority or the prescribed authority, as the case may be, and thereafter, but subject to the provisions of section 3, it shall be lawful for the person who has applied for permission, or his successor-in-interest, to transfer such land by sale, mortgage, gift, lease or otherwise.
     Explanation.--In computing the period of three years, under this section, in relation to any land, the period during which the acquisition proceedings in relation to such land have been stayed by any court shall be excluded
